APACC is interested in two items in the February 1 DCR:

  • Funding for the Anacostia Ambassador Program: DOEE has received federal funds to grant out for the Anacostia Ambassador Program and is seeking applicants. The announcement (Word) says, “Through the Urban Waters Federal Partnerships, this program aims to strengthen the coordination of present and future efforts of the District's local stakeholders that implement water quality improvements in the Anacostia Watershed. There is one award available for this project, with a project period of one (1) year. Depending on the performance of the grantee and the availability of funds, the grant may be extended for up to two (2) additional years for a total of three (3) years. The amount available for the project is approximately $90,000.” Applications are due March 4.
